/a:setup — author the project's anchored.yml
anchored.yml is deliberately tiny. Everything you may write, exhaustively:
fields: # top-level, for ALL setups — record form name: type
commit: string # string | number | boolean
defaults: # the setup shape, used when a criterion has no setup
validator: { instructions: "…", require: grounded } # `require` optional, see below
before: { instructions: "…" }
after: { instructions: "…" }
setups:
frontend: # user-named; EXACTLY the same three slots as defaults
validator: { instructions: "…" }
before: { instructions: "…" }
after: { instructions: "…" }
Full commented example: references/anchored.example.yml.
The guardrails (you enforce these while authoring)
- A setup is verification know-how for one kind of work — the domain axis. It attaches
per criterion at run time. It is parametrisation of the ONE loop, never a step sequence:
no
steps, noextends, no nesting. The schema rejects them; don't try. - Hooks are instructions the agent executes, not harness-run command lists — that's
what lets them wrap context around a CLI call ("run
bun run typecheck; treat red as a failed gate"). Write them as instruction prose containing the concrete commands.beforeruns ahead of each validator spawn for that setup's gates;afteron a setup fires when one of its gates goes green;afterondefaultsis the close-time hook. validator.require: groundedis the one HARD knob — the only place config stops being advice. It makes a setup refuse a prose verdict: proof must carry the real output of something the validator ran (UngroundedEvidenceotherwise). Offer it where the subject is genuinely executable and the stakes are high (areleasesetup); never make it the default, and never put it on a setup that verifies assets, copy or design — those are proven by inspection, and that is proof too. Criteria markedjudgment: truestay exempt everywhere. It merges DOWN: set ondefaults, a named setup keeps it even when it writes its owninstructions.- NOT config, by design — refuse politely and say where it lives instead:
rigor/ quality bar → per task, in the run file, from the user's words at anchor time- gate layout → the AI slices gates itself, sized to the rigor
- architecture/conventions →
.claude/rules/(every validator reads them anyway) - git/CI built-ins → don't exist; wire them via hook instructions +
fields
- Custom fields are top-level and shared by all setups; a hook fills them via
anchored set <slug> <cN> <field>=<value>.
